Smart locks, as the name suggests, use electronic and biometric technologies to achieve intelligent management of door locks. Unlike traditional mechanical locks, smart locks typically employ multiple unlocking methods such as passwords, fingerprints, facial recognition, and remote control via a mobile app. Their core lies in the built-in microprocessor, which can identify and verify the user's identity information. Once verification is successful, it drives the lock cylinder to complete the unlocking action. Some high-end smart locks also feature anti-pry alarms and intrusion logging functions, significantly enhancing home security.
